alicloud.vpn.GatewayVcoRoute

Explore with Pulumi AI

Provides a VPN Gateway Vco Route resource.

For information about VPN Gateway Vco Route and how to use it, see What is Vco Route.

NOTE: Available since v1.183.0+.

Example Usage

Basic Usage

import * as pulumi from "@pulumi/pulumi";
import * as alicloud from "@pulumi/alicloud";

const config = new pulumi.Config();
const name = config.get("name") || "tf-example";
const defaultInstance = new alicloud.cen.Instance("default", {cenInstanceName: name});
const defaultTransitRouter = new alicloud.cen.TransitRouter("default", {
    cenId: defaultInstance.id,
    transitRouterDescription: name,
    transitRouterName: name,
});
const defaultTransitRouterCidr = new alicloud.cen.TransitRouterCidr("default", {
    transitRouterId: defaultTransitRouter.transitRouterId,
    cidr: "192.168.0.0/16",
    transitRouterCidrName: name,
    description: name,
    publishCidrRoute: true,
});
const _default = alicloud.cen.getTransitRouterAvailableResources({});
const defaultCustomerGateway = new alicloud.vpn.CustomerGateway("default", {
    customerGatewayName: name,
    ipAddress: "42.104.22.210",
    asn: "45014",
    description: name,
});
const defaultGatewayVpnAttachment = new alicloud.vpn.GatewayVpnAttachment("default", {
    customerGatewayId: defaultCustomerGateway.id,
    networkType: "public",
    localSubnet: "0.0.0.0/0",
    remoteSubnet: "0.0.0.0/0",
    effectImmediately: false,
    ikeConfig: {
        ikeAuthAlg: "md5",
        ikeEncAlg: "des",
        ikeVersion: "ikev2",
        ikeMode: "main",
        ikeLifetime: 86400,
        psk: "tf-examplevpn2",
        ikePfs: "group1",
        remoteId: "testbob2",
        localId: "testalice2",
    },
    ipsecConfig: {
        ipsecPfs: "group5",
        ipsecEncAlg: "des",
        ipsecAuthAlg: "md5",
        ipsecLifetime: 86400,
    },
    bgpConfig: {
        enable: true,
        localAsn: 45014,
        tunnelCidr: "169.254.11.0/30",
        localBgpIp: "169.254.11.1",
    },
    healthCheckConfig: {
        enable: true,
        sip: "192.168.1.1",
        dip: "10.0.0.1",
        interval: 10,
        retry: 10,
        policy: "revoke_route",
    },
    enableDpd: true,
    enableNatTraversal: true,
    vpnAttachmentName: name,
});
const defaultTransitRouterVpnAttachment = new alicloud.cen.TransitRouterVpnAttachment("default", {
    autoPublishRouteEnabled: false,
    transitRouterAttachmentDescription: name,
    transitRouterAttachmentName: name,
    cenId: defaultTransitRouter.cenId,
    transitRouterId: defaultTransitRouterCidr.transitRouterId,
    vpnId: defaultGatewayVpnAttachment.id,
    zones: [{
        zoneId: _default.then(_default => _default.resources?.[0]?.masterZones?.[0]),
    }],
});
const defaultGatewayVcoRoute = new alicloud.vpn.GatewayVcoRoute("default", {
    nextHop: defaultTransitRouterVpnAttachment.vpnId,
    vpnConnectionId: defaultTransitRouterVpnAttachment.vpnId,
    weight: 100,
    routeDest: "192.168.10.0/24",
});
Copy

GatewayVcoRoute Resource Properties

To learn more about resource properties and how to use them, see Inputs and Outputs in the Architecture and Concepts docs.

Inputs

In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.

The GatewayVcoRoute resource accepts the following input properties:

NextHop
This property is required.
Changes to this property will trigger replacement.
string
The next hop of the destination route.
RouteDest
This property is required.
Changes to this property will trigger replacement.
string
The destination network segment of the destination route.
VpnConnectionId
This property is required.
Changes to this property will trigger replacement.
string
The id of the vpn attachment.
Weight
This property is required.
Changes to this property will trigger replacement.
int
The weight value of the destination route. Valid values: 0, 100.
OverlayMode Changes to this property will trigger replacement. string
The tunneling protocol. Set the value to Ipsec, which specifies the IPsec tunneling protocol.

Outputs

All input properties are implicitly available as output properties. Additionally, the GatewayVcoRoute resource produces the following output properties:

Id string
The provider-assigned unique ID for this managed resource.
Status string
The status of the vpn route entry.

Import

VPN Gateway Vco Route can be imported using the id, e.g.

$ pulumi import alicloud:vpn/gatewayVcoRoute:GatewayVcoRoute example <vpn_connection_id>:<route_dest>:<next_hop>:<weight>
